The Chemical Advantage of 5-Chloro-2-iodopyridine
With its unique molecular structure, C5H3ClIN, 5-Chloro-2-iodopyridine offers distinct reactive sites. The iodine atom is particularly susceptible to metal-catalyzed cross-coupling reactions, a cornerstone of modern organic chemistry for forming carbon-carbon and carbon-heteroatom bonds. This reactivity profile makes it invaluable for constructing complex molecular architectures, which are often the targets in pharmaceutical and agrochemical research. Typically supplied with a purity of ≥98.0%, this white powder is a reliable choice for applications demanding precision and efficiency.
Applications Across Key Industries
The utility of 5-Chloro-2-iodopyridine spans several critical sectors:
- Pharmaceuticals: It acts as a vital intermediate in the synthesis of various drug candidates, contributing to the development of novel treatments for diseases. Its ability to be functionalized selectively allows chemists to create diverse libraries of potential therapeutic molecules.
- Agrochemicals: This compound is instrumental in the creation of advanced crop protection agents. By enabling the synthesis of effective herbicides, pesticides, and fungicides, it plays a role in enhancing agricultural productivity and sustainability.
- Materials Science: Beyond life sciences, it is employed in synthesizing specialty chemicals and advanced materials where specific halogenated pyridine motifs are required for desired properties.
